![]() Printf() then prints the clear text on the computer screen, and the morsecod() function causes the buzzer and the LED to emit Morse code. When you type the relevant characters with the keyboard, code=strupr(code) will convert the input letters to their capital form. Ĭhar lookup(char key,struct MORSE dict,int length)īefore coding, you need to unify the letters into capital letters.Ĭhar code int length=8 code = (char)malloc(sizeof(char)*length) ![]() Gcc 3.1.11_MorseCodeGenerator.c -lwiringPiĪfter the program runs, type a series of characters, and the buzzer and the LED will send the corresponding Morse code signals.Ĭode structure MORSE is the dictionary of the Morse code, containing characters A-Z, numbers 0-9 and marks “?” “/” “:” “,” “.” “ ” “!”. Step 1: Build the circuit. (Pay attention to poles of the buzzer: The one with + label is the positive pole and the other is the negative.)Ĭd /home /pi /davinci-kit-for-raspberry-pi/c/3.1.11/ In this lesson, we’ll make a Morse code generator, where you type in a series of English letters in the Raspberry Pi to make it appear as Morse code. 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|